This is what I do also, and I get the same kind of misbehavior. In
the case of xemacs, I tend to click on the "Copy" button in the
toolbar rather than using Cmd-C.
Interestingly, I'm experiencing copy-and-paste failure in xemacs
right now as I compose this post. None of the following works for
copying in xemacs and pasting into Terminal.app (I get the old
contents of the clipboard/pasteboard):
* click on "Copy" in toolbar
* select Edit->Copy from the *xemacs* menu
* click on "Cut" in toolbar (the selection disappears as expected,
but I get the old contents on paste)
* select Edit->Cut from the xemacs menu (same behavior as "Cut"
toolbar button)
* invoking the xemacs function copy-primary-selection
In the past, I could sometimes unwedge things by copying in Aqua,
pasting in Aqua, and then retrying copying from xemacs. No go this
time.
But this is where it gets interesting. If I now select Edit->Copy
from *X11.app* (or hit Cmd-C), then pasting to Aqua works. So, at
least in this particular instance of failure, Cmd-C works as
advertised. It's possible I haven't tried using Cmd-C enough in the
past and that things would work more often if I stuck with
exclusively using Cmd-C. I'll try this and see how things go.
